Baby Monitors: Keeping an Eye on Your Little One

Baby monitors have become an essential tool for modern parents, providing peace of mind and allowing them to keep a watchful eye on their infants from anywhere in the home. These devices have evolved significantly over the years, offering advanced features such as video streaming, two-way audio communication, and even vital sign monitoring.
